Dr. Praeger's California Veggie Burgers recalled due to Listeria

4 months ago source accessdata.fda.gov

United States

Dr. Praeger's Sensible Foods Inc. has initiated a voluntary recall of its California Veggie Burgers due to potential Listeria contamination. The affected product was distributed to retail locations in Florida, New Jersey, and New York in the United States.

The recall involves:
- Dr. Praeger's California Veggie Burgers
- Packaged in 10-oz boxes with six packages per master case.
- The specific lot number is I25BB-01A
- Product number VBCA06
- UPC code 080868000107.
- A total of 648 master cases are included in the recall.

The issue was discovered when the equipment used to produce the burgers tested positive for Listeria. The recall was initiated on September 22, 2025, and is classified as a Class II recall as of October 31, 2025.
